I originally received this engine on trade for some racing parts I had. The motor has been out of the car in heated storage for 2 years. I was told the engine should be fine with the carbs rebuilt and distributor adjusted. The car it came out of was a high dollar 1964 lightweight car and the owner reunited the car with it's original motor, so this one came out. I have had the valve covers off only and everything looks really clean, also confirmed cylinder head numbers and factory adjustable rocker arms. When I took the motor out of the crate I noticed the corner on the drivers side exhaust manifold flange is broken off and had been used with a bolt and a couple of washers with no issue. Also, the bolt hole boss under where the starter would mount is broken, again used with no issue. I am discounting the motor to $8500 obo from $10K because of the 2 issues. PM me here. *** I was able to lift the engine pad numbers using acid ***

Engine pad reads: 426T.....the rest I could not read and a build
date of 11-20-62.


- AAQA block standard bore 8/24/62 casting #2406730-1 RL, 2400 miles on short block with all stock parts.

- 11:1 compression

- original untouched Stage III 518 heads #2406518

- 3447 carbs

- has a street Hemi oil pan

- cross ram 2402726

- correct exhaust manifolds with correct numbers #2402336 & #2402334

- has a NOS Max Wedge distributor #2444272

- complete carb linkage and carb fuel lines.

- correct water pump #2205862, fan and pulleys.

- Hemi fuel pump carter #4024S

- original style plug wires

- engine will need coil and alternator (bracket is included) to run
